Devon Edward Sawa (born September 7, 1978) is a Canadian actor. He began his career as a child actor, making his film debut with a supporting role in Little Giants (1994). He later portrayed the human form of Casper the Friendly Ghost in the fantasy film Casper (1995) and had starring roles in the films Wild America (1997), SLC Punk! (1998), and Idle Hands (1999).

Sawa had his breakout with a lead role as Alex Browning in the supernatural horror film Final Destination (2000). Following lead roles in the films Slackers (2002) and Extreme Ops (2002), Sawa mostly acted in direct-to-video productions for the remainder of the 2000s. In the 2010s, he had a recurring, later main, role as Owen Elliot / Sam Matthews on the CW television series Nikita (2010–2013). He also had a main role as Nico Jackson on the ABC series Somewhere Between (2017) and reprised his SLC Punk! role in the film's sequel, Punk's Dead (2016).

In the 2020s, Sawa experienced a career resurgence. He played multiple roles, both recurring and main, on the Syfy and USA Network horror series Chucky (2021–2024), and had a starring role in the horror film Heart Eyes (2025).

Early lifeEdit

Devon Sawa was born on September 7, 1978,<ref>Template:Cite news</ref> in Vancouver, the son of Joyce and Edward Sawa, a mechanic. He has two older siblings. His father was of Polish descent, and his mother is "a little bit of everything".<ref name="feb2000int" />

CareerEdit

Sawa began his career in 1992 at age 14 as a children's action toy spokesman. He made his film debut in Little Giants in 1994 and received wide recognition for playing the title role as a human boy in Casper the following year. In Now and Then (1995), Sawa played the town bully, Scott Wormer. He subsequently appeared in the films Wild America (1997), SLC Punk! (1998), Idle Hands (1999), and Final Destination (2000). In 2000, Sawa played the title character of the Eminem music video "Stan".<ref>D. Sawa DevonSawa.org Filmography: "Stan" Template:Webarchive</ref> He later did voice acting, voicing Flash Thompson in Spider-Man: The New Animated Series. Sawa continued to work steadily in the 2000s by appearing in several independent films, including Extreme Dating, Shooting Gallery, Devil's Den, Creature Of Darkness, Endure, 388 Arletta Avenue, The Philly Kid, and A Resurrection.<ref>{{#invoke:citation/CS1|citation |CitationClass=web }}</ref><ref>{{#invoke:citation/CS1|citation |CitationClass=web }}</ref>

In 2010, Sawa portrayed Owen Elliott on The CW action drama series Nikita.<ref name=nikita/><ref name=nikitaowen/> In July 2012, he was promoted to series regular in the third season of Nikita; the show ended after four seasons in 2013.<ref name=tvl120711/> In 2016, Sawa played the lead role in Punk's Dead, a sequel to SLC Punk! by the same director James Merendino. In 2017, he portrayed the role of Nico Jackson in Somewhere Between; the show ended after one season. In 2019, Sawa appeared as Lester Clark Jr. in Escape Plan: The Extractors.<ref>Template:Cite news</ref> He also starred in the thriller The Fanatic, where he played Hunter Dunbar, an actor who is stalked by a character named Moose (John Travolta). The movie was directed by Limp Bizkit vocalist Fred Durst. Sawa later starred in the films Hunter Hunter (2020) and Black Friday (2021), which received favorable reviews.<ref>{{#invoke:citation/CS1|citation |CitationClass=web }}</ref><ref>{{#invoke:citation/CS1|citation |CitationClass=web }}</ref>

Personal lifeEdit

Sawa married Canadian producer Dawni Sahanovitch in 2013.<ref>{{#invoke:citation/CS1|citation |CitationClass=web }}</ref> They have two children together, a son born in 2014 and a daughter born in 2016.<ref>{{#invoke:citation/CS1|citation |CitationClass=web }}</ref><ref>{{#invoke:citation/CS1|citation |CitationClass=web }}</ref><ref>Template:Cite news</ref>

Sawa has described himself as being irreligious, an atheist, and supportive of religious freedoms.<ref>Template:Cite tweet</ref><ref>Template:Cite tweet</ref>

In June 2022, Sawa gave a lengthy interview to The Independent, where he said that he sought out roles in which the character smoked marijuana to help get away from his teen heartthrob status which began with Casper. Sawa also said that between 2004 and 2009, he "drank a lot" until going sober after meeting his wife in Vancouver.<ref>{{#invoke:citation/CS1|citation |CitationClass=web }}</ref>
